Strategic Placement and Visual Hierarchy
While the Christmas Dachshund Dog Lover Jolly Paw is charming, strategic placement is key to maintaining a professional brand identity. In design, we talk about visual hierarchy—guiding the customer’s eye to the most important information first. This asset should act as a supporting element that enhances the message, not competes with it.
It works best when used as a decorative brand element around essential text like your logo, product name, or price. For example, placing the dachshund illustration in the corner of a product label allows the typography to remain legible and clear. This approach ensures better product recognition while still delivering the festive mood.
However, there are areas where this asset requires careful consideration. Avoid using it in formal corporate branding contexts where a sleek, minimalist aesthetic is required. Similarly, do not place it in crowded product packaging layouts where ingredient lists or legal information must be clearly visible. If the background is low-contrast or busy, the details of the illustration may get lost, reducing its impact. For luxury minimalist brands, the playful nature of the dog might clash with the desired tone of exclusivity and restraint.
Practical Designer Notes for Implementation
Before incorporating the Christmas Dachshund Dog Lover Jolly Paw into your commercial projects, consider these practical steps to ensure high-quality results:
- Test on Real Mockups: Do not judge the asset solely on a white background. Place it on actual packaging materials, such as glass jars, cardboard boxes, or fabric bags, to see how it interacts with different textures and colors.
- Check Black and White Usage: Preview the illustration in grayscale. This helps determine if the design holds up when printed on monochrome printers or if it relies too heavily on color contrast.
- Font Pairing: Experiment with typography alongside the illustration. Test it beside serif fonts for a classic look, sans serif fonts for modern clarity, script fonts for elegance, or handwritten fonts for a personal touch. The right font pairing elevates the entire composition.
- File Format Inspection: Verify whether the asset is provided as a PNG design with transparency or an SVG design for scalability. Vector files allow you to resize the illustration without losing quality, which is essential for large-format prints like posters or banners.
- Commercial Licensing: Always confirm the commercial license before using the asset for client work, business branding, or physical product sales. Even if sourced from a creative marketplace as a freebie, usage rights vary significantly.
